Overview

Adipiodone is a a tri-iodinated benzoate derivative and an ionic dimeric contrast agent that is FDA approved for the procedure of diagnostic imaging, as this agent blocks x-ray and appears opaque on x-ray film; thereby it enhances the visibility of the bile ducts and gallbladder during cholangiography and cholecystography procedures. Common adverse reactions include epilepsy, abdominal pain, and tremor.

Adverse Reactions

Clinical Trials Experience

  • Stevens-Johnson Syndrome (SJS)
  • Toxic Epidermal Necrolysis (TEN)
  • Drug Reaction with Eosinophilia and Systemic Symptoms (DRESS)
  • Acute Generalized Exanthematous Pustulosis (AGEP) associated with iodinated contrast media
